FAQs

Does the Bose QuietComfort 25 have active noise cancellation?

Yes, the Bose QuietComfort 25 features active noise cancellation, which effectively reduces ambient sounds, making it ideal for use in noisy environments like airplanes or busy streets.

Can the Bose QuietComfort 25 headphones be used with a mobile device?

Yes, the Bose QuietComfort 25 headphones come with a detachable cable that includes an inline remote and microphone, making them compatible with most mobile devices for calls and music control.

What type of battery does the Bose QuietComfort 25 use?

The Bose QuietComfort 25 headphones require a single AAA battery to power the active noise cancellation feature, providing up to 35 hours of use.

Are the Bose QuietComfort 25 headphones comfortable for long listening sessions?

The Bose QuietComfort 25 headphones are designed with plush ear cushions and a lightweight headband, providing comfort for extended listening sessions.

How does the sound quality of the Bose QuietComfort 25 compare to other headphones?

The Bose QuietComfort 25 headphones deliver balanced sound with deep bass and clear highs, making them a popular choice for those seeking high-quality audio alongside effective noise cancellation.

Owner Insights

We analyzed real musician discussions from forums and Reddit to find what players love, question, and tweak about Bose QuietComfort 25.

Mods and upgrades

  • Aftermarket Bluetooth adapters, priced between $20-$50, can convert QC25s to wireless, offering a practical workaround for the lack of native Bluetooth.

    Source

Setup and maintenance

  • Replacing earcups is straightforward, with some owners preferring Dekoni Leather pads for longevity over original Bose ones.

    Source

Features and functionality

  • The QC25 relies on AAA batteries, which some users prefer for eliminating battery degradation concerns common in rechargeable models.

    Source
  • The QC Ultra's NC takes 2-4 seconds to activate, unlike the instant activation on the QC25.

    Source
  • The "Aware" mode on QC Ultra reportedly amplifies background noise rather than just allowing speech through, contrasting with expectations.

    Source
  • The QC25 can effectively cancel noise even when used without a cord and earbuds underneath, maintaining its NC capabilities.

    Source
  • The QC25 excels in reducing low and mid-frequency sounds, particularly effective against airplane engines, traffic, and air conditioning hums.

    Source

User experience

  • The mechanical switch for noise cancellation is favored for its simplicity, avoiding the potential faults of touch sensors found in newer models.

    Source
  • Owners noted that the minimum volume on the QC Ultras is higher than desired for sleep, compared to the QC25.

    Source
  • There's difficulty in fine-controlling volume with the QC Ultra's slider, often resulting in unintended large adjustments.

    Source
  • Owners emphasize the QC25's ability to significantly aid concentration and focus in noisy environments, enhancing productivity.

    Source
  • While effective at low and mid frequencies, the QC25 struggles more with high-pitched sounds like sirens or crying babies.

    Source

Comparisons

  • Bose QC25s are noted to be more comfortable and sturdier than the Sony WH-1000XM series, although the latter offers better sound quality and noise cancellation.

    Source
  • Users found the QC Ultra's noise cancellation less effective and more intrusive than the QC25, especially in dynamic travel environments.

    Source

Use cases and applications

  • Users report QC25s are ideal for travel and loud environments like woodworking, effectively reducing background hum but less so for voices.

    Source
  • The QC25 is highly recommended for creating a peaceful environment for relaxation and sleep, even in loud settings.

    Source

namesuppressed

Blissful. My fave tech purchase. Even with the manufacturing defect...

I love these headphones, the noise cancelling is pure bliss. Whether I'm on a plane, a train, walking through the street or mowing the lawn, putting these headphones on makes the stress of the world disappear. I love that the QC25s use AAA batteries, so when the power gets low I can swap the battery & be up & running immediately, no down time or remembering to charge them. I love that the cord is removable & can be replaced if you switch from iPhone to Android. The sound quality could be better (the high end is a bit dull, missing some of the lowest bass), but they're really enjoyable and comfortable to wear everywhere. And I use these while first building a song, when I want to have fun & not be analytical about the sound. I honestly can't be without these headphones, so much that I also own a backup pair in case one breaks.

And that's the catch: there is a manufacturing flaw in the left ear cup that causes the noise cancelling to stop working after a year of use. This is the third time I've had this problem. (Search for "Bose QC25 left ear" and note the results.) Thankfully Bose is usually gracious enough to give a free replacement the first time, and Bose have a policy to swap their products at-cost for any reason if you buy direct from them. But be aware, you could be paying every year to replace these things. As long as you're okay with that... wow, the noise cancelling & comfort makes these such a good purchase.

jean_michel_destcroix

The Best noise canceling from headphones I ever experienced

The sound is always crisp and clear regardless to the noise canceling. They are very comfortable thanks to nicely padded ear cups and headband and light weight. The noise canceling "white noise" you usually get from noise canceling headphone is almost gone and can bearly be heard without music on; music on at a low volume is enough to eliminate all exterior (reasonably loud) sounds. I wear them every day on my morning commute to school and it easily blocks out the sound of screaming children. Would recommend. Worth every penny.
